Check for Certifications and Experience
Dog grooming is more than just a haircut; it involves understanding different breeds, coat types, and potential sensitivities. Look for groomers who are certified by reputable organizations like the National Dog Groomers Association of America (NDGAA). Certification demonstrates a commitment to professional standards and continuing education. Furthermore, inquire about the groomers’ experience. A groomer with years of experience is likely better equipped to handle various breeds and temperaments, ensuring a comfortable and safe experience for your furry friend.
Assess the Salon’s Environment
A walk-in groomer should have a clean, well-maintained, and pet-friendly environment. Visit the salon during off-peak hours to get a feel for the atmosphere. Observe the grooming stations, bathing areas, and holding cages. Are they clean and sanitized? Is there adequate ventilation? A positive and relaxed environment will help reduce stress for your dog. Look for signs that the groomers prioritize animal welfare, such as gentle handling techniques and a focus on positive reinforcement.
Inquire About Services and Pricing
Walk-in groomers often offer a range of services, from basic baths and brush-outs to full haircuts and nail trims. Before committing, inquire about the specific services offered and their corresponding prices. Be sure to ask if there are additional charges for de-matting, flea treatments, or specialized shampoos. Clear communication about pricing will prevent any surprises at checkout. Also, confirm if they have breed-specific grooming experience, especially if your dog has a particular coat type that requires specialized care.
Consider Your Dog’s Temperament
Not all dogs are comfortable with the hustle and bustle of a walk-in grooming salon. If your dog is particularly anxious or sensitive, a quieter, appointment-based groomer might be a better option. However, if your dog is generally well-behaved and enjoys meeting new people, a walk-in groomer can be a convenient and affordable solution. Observe how the groomers interact with other dogs in the salon. A gentle and reassuring approach is a good sign.
